Key Evaluative Factors for Mortgage Lenders #
Mortgage lenders consider a variety of factors when assessing the viability of financing different property types. Below are the primary components they evaluate:
1. Property Location #
The location remains a critical factor in the evaluation process. Properties situated in regions with stable or increasing property values are often more favorable to lenders. 2025 has seen a surge in the interest for homes in suburban areas and smaller cities, as remote work influences residential choices.
2. Property Condition and Age #
The condition and age of a property play a significant role in a lender’s assessment. Newer properties or those that have undergone recent renovations typically present lower risk. Older homes may require additional scrutiny, especially if they need substantial repairs, impacting the loan terms.
3. Property Type #
Different property types may have specific considerations. Single-family homes, condos, and multi-family units each come with unique risk assessments. For instance, condos may be subject to homeowner association (HOA) rules, which could influence lending decisions.
4. Market Trends and Demand #
Current market trends can heavily influence a lender’s willingness to approve a mortgage. In 2025, there is a growing preference for eco-friendly properties and smart homes, reflecting consumer demand and technological advancement.
5. Legal and Zoning Restrictions #
Legal aspects, such as zoning laws and property usage permits, are pivotal in a lender’s evaluation. Compliance with local regulations ensures the property is a viable and safe investment.
